- 10. 5 Modeling Techniques: Rules of Thumb Don’t start from scratch at the beginning; Consider modifying an existing strategy to fit your trading plan Articulate clearly the pattern you wish to identify – writing it down first (like a grocery list) can help clarify your purpose (vs. shopping while hungry) Draw your best trade on a chart and clearly label each axis – this works in selecting the correct alerts and filters for your timeframe Separate bullish or up-trending strategies from bearish or down-trending strategies – this allows for more ways to ‘stack the probabilities’ of movement in a certain direction Use the many support resources available!
